| Feature | pleut | pût |
|---|---|---|
| Definition | Troisième personne du singulier de l’indicatif présent de pleuvoir. | Troisième personne du singulier de l’imparfait du subjonctif du verbe pouvoir. |

Why the eye confuses pleut with pût
A purely visual mix-up. pleut (\plø\) and pût (\py\)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one.
